<div class="refsect1">
<a name="idm45555153915472"></a><h2>Description</h2>
<p>Class <code class="computeroutput"><a class="link" href="rand48.html" title="Class rand48">rand48</a></code> models a <a class="link" href="../../boost_random/reference.html#boost_random.reference.concepts.pseudo_random_number_generator" title="Pseudo-Random Number Generator">pseudo-random number generator</a> . It uses the linear congruential algorithm with the parameters a = 0x5DEECE66D, c = 0xB, m = 2**48. It delivers identical results to the <code class="computeroutput">lrand48()</code> function available on some systems (assuming lcong48 has not been called).</p>
<p>It is only available on systems where <code class="computeroutput">uint64_t</code> is provided as an integral type, so that for example static in-class constants and/or enum definitions with large <code class="computeroutput">uint64_t</code> numbers work. </p>
